Is odorization required for the gasification and transmission of LNG?

2018-06-13View Original

Thread Content

(1) Under normal operating conditions (outside unloading periods), the composition of the pipeline-transmitted natural gas is the same as that of LNG. Due to the large volume of BOG during unloading, the nitrogen content in the composition of the pipeline-transported natural gas has increased slightly. The product standards for pipeline-transported natural gas comply with GB17820 “Natural Gas”. Its classification follows GB/T13611 “Classification of City Natural Gas”, and it falls within the 12 t range. The temperature of the natural gas transported externally is above 0°C, the transmission pressure is 7.2 MPa, no odorant is added, and no adjustment of calorific value is made.

According to the specifications, odorization is not required for the gas in the transmission pipeline from the starting point to the terminal. Odorant is added starting from the buffer tank at the terminal’s inlet up to its outlet; from there, the gas is delivered to users via various branch pipelines.
